Which sentence has the correct comma placement? Mark Twain was fond of condemning lying by saying "If you tell the truth, you do
Dafna1 [17]

Answer:

Mark Twain was fond of condemning lying by saying, "If you tell the truth, you don’t have to remember anything."

Explanation:

Quotations are usually used with a colon after a sentence. However, they can also be introduced with a comma when there is an introductory phrase before it, such as <em>by saying</em>. On the other hand, when the quotation is introduced in the sentence, the comma is not necessary, like the first sentence.
